Determine the amount of your damages

A personal injury lawyer can help you determine the amount of your losses. They can evaluate your case and present the information to the insurance adjuster. They can also assist you receive reimbursement for medical expenses.

The first step in calculating your damages involves determining how much the pain you've felt. This includes emotional anguish anxiety, stress, stress and any other physical injuries.

Next, you'll need to determine the value of your medical expenses. These include the cost of emergency room costs diagnostic tests, as well as prescription medications. You might be able to pay for these expenses through your health insurance company.

It is also important to estimate the cost of medical bills in the future. This includes hospitalization, outstanding bills, and medical lien. You can refer to the records of your current doctor to establish these costs.

You'll also need to calculate the cost of lost wages. This will vary from person to person. It is possible to determine this by assessing the length of time you were unable to work. An expert can help determine how much you could earn in the future.

In addition, you'll have to determine the value of the damage you've suffered. These are usually referred to "general" and "special". These damages can include future earnings, lost wage, and out-of pocket expenses.

Multiplying all tangible expenses by a multiplier is a common method of estimating the non-economic cost. The multiplier could range between 1.5 to 5.

The severity of your injury will determine the magnitude you choose. The higher your multiplier, the greater the value of your damages.

The statute of limitations, which is a legal term refers to the time an individual has to file an action. It could vary from one year to six years according to the state in which it is.

There are different rules for different kinds of claims. For example, there is a special statute of limitations for criminal and products liability cases. There is also a special statute of limitations for claims against governmental entities.
